Cài đặt MongoDB trên Ubuntu Server

MongoDB là mã nguồn mở dùng để quản trị các cơ sở dữ liệu không quan hệ (NoSQL). MongoDB được coi là một trong những cơ sở dữ liệu mã nguồn mở NoSQL phổ biến nhất được biết bằng C++. Đây là cơ sở dữ liệu hướng tài liệu, nó lưu trữ dữ liệu trong các document dạng JSON với schema động rất linh hoạt. Điều này có nghĩa là bạn có thể lưu các bản ghi mà không cần lo lắng về cấu trúc dữ liệu như là số trường, kiểu của trường lưu trữ. Tài liệu MongoDB tương tự như các đối tượng JSON.

Để cài đặt MongoDB, bạn có thể cài đặt qua Ubuntu Software Repository hoặc qua các Package do MongoDB cung cấp.

1. Cài đặt qua Ubuntu Software Repository

Các package cung cấp bởi Ubuntu Software Repository như mongodb, mongodb-servermongodb-clients. Để cài đặt bạn chỉ cần chạy câu lệnh sau:


apt-get install mongodb

2. Cài đặt qua MongoDB

MongoDB cung cấp các gói package sau để cài đặt MongoDB và các tool và component liên quan dành cho các phiên bảnUbuntu 64-bit LTS:

  • mongodb-org: Đây là gói metapackage dùng để cài đặt tất cả các component và tool liên quan
  • mongodb-org-server: Bao gồm mongod deamon và các đoạn script để cấu hình và khởi tạo server.
  • mongodb-org-mongos: Bao gồm mongos deamon.
  • mongodb-org-shell: Bao gồm mongo shell.
  • mongodb-org-tools: Bao gồm các tool liên quan như mongoimport, bsondump, mongodump, mongoexport

Để cài đặt, Bạn cần thực hiện theo các bước tại đây: https://docs.mongodb.com/manual/tutorial/install-mongodb-on-ubuntu/

*) Ghi chú: Bạn chỉ nên cài đặt thông qua 1 trong 2 cách trên vì nếu không cài đúng sẽ dễ dẫn đến conflict giữa các gói.

Thông thường, Bạn nên cài đặt thông qua các gói cung cấp bởi MongoDB bởi các gói ở đây là các gói được cập nhật thường xuyên và Bạn sẽ sử dụng được các phiên bản MongoDB mới nhất. Hướng dẫn cài đặt lại phụ thuộc vào từng phiên bản nên các bạn xem ở link trên nhé.

Nguồn: tổng hợp từ internet.

Trả lời

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*